I N S T A L L A T I O N
(1) Install the weatherstrip seal on the window
glass (Fig. 17).

(2) Apply mastic or equivalent to window opening
at roof joint upper corners.
(3) Install the window glass (or frame) and the
weatherstrip seal in the window opening with a
length of cord (Fig. 17) according to the following in­
structions:
• Moisten a length of 6 mm (0.25 in) diameter cord
with a soap and water solution.
• Ensure that the cord is long enough to go all the
way around the perimeter of the weatherstrip seal.
• Insert the cord into the window opening flange
channel in the weatherstrip seal (Fig. 17).
• Position the window glass and the weatherstrip
seal in the window opening with the free ends of the
cord inside the vehicle. The cords must be positioned
at the bottom center of the window opening.
• Pull evenly and simultaneously on each end of the
cord (Fig. 13) to pull the weatherstrip seal channel
lip over the window opening flange. (Both cords must
reach the lower corners at the same time to ensure a
proper seal.)

• Push around perimeter to seat bottom of glass.
(4) Test the window for water leaks.
(5) Clean the vehicle, as necessary.
(6) Install quarter trim panels.
SLIDING REAR WINDOW—CLUB CAB
To remove the sliding rear window in a club cab,
refer to the rear window removal/installation proce­
dures for club cab vehicles.
